It could be due to nerve pressure, vitamin deficiency or a tight fitting shoes.Do a vitamin b 12 test and consult a physician in your area for a clinical examination to determine the exact cause.

"Alleviate a burning sensation in the foot with a home diet rich in B vitamins, particularly B12 from fish, eggs, and dairy, and B6 from bananas, potatoes, and chicken, as well as magnesium-rich foods like dark leafy greens, nuts, and seeds to help regulate nerve function.

Intermittent burning sensations can be caused by various factors, including nerve issues, circulation problems, or even certain medical conditions. Here are a few possibilities to consider: Peripheral Neuropathy: This condition affects the nerves and can cause burning, tingling, or numbness. It can be due to diabetes, vitamin deficiencies, or other underlying health issues. Circulatory Problems: Poor blood flow to the feet can cause burning sensations. Conditions like peripheral artery disease (PAD) might be a factor. Nerve Compression: Issues like sciatica or tarsal tunnel syndrome can cause intermittent burning sensations due to nerve compression. Infections or Inflammation: Infections, such as athlete’s foot, or inflammatory conditions like plantar fasciitis, can also cause burning sensations. Given your medical background, you might already be considering these possibilities. However, it’s important to get a thorough evaluation to pinpoint the exact cause. Here are some steps you might take: Blood Tests: Checking for diabetes, vitamin deficiencies, or other metabolic conditions. Imaging Studies: MRI or ultrasound might be necessary to check for nerve compression or circulatory issues. In the meantime, you might find some relief with: Proper Footwear: Ensure your shoes provide good support and are not too tight. Foot Soaks: Warm water soaks with Epsom salt can sometimes help alleviate discomfort. Topical Treatments: Over-the-counter creams containing capsaicin or lidocaine might provide temporary relief.
